Sr Software Engineer AuthN / AuthZ (80-100% Zurich Hybrid) Your Mission

We are seeking for a highly motivated and talented Software Engineer person to join our growing AuthN / AuthZ team. As a Senior Software Engineer, you will be a key driver in enhancing our identity and access management platform. Your responsibilities will include:

  • Identity Provider:
    You will help us to design, develop and operate a highly scalable identity provider solution
  • Access Management:
    Migrating our old‑fashined permissions model into a modern ReBAC‑based solution.
  • Leading Cross‑Team Projects:
    Take ownership of complex platform projects. This includes defining scope, managing dependencies, and communicating progress to successful completion
  • Structured Problem‑Solving:
    Tackle difficult architectural and operational challenges with a structured and methodical approach.

This position will give you the opportunity to drive midsize to large projects, right from the concept phase all the way through to production deployment and operations. You will collaborate with cross‑functional teams to identify and implement improvements to the AuthN / AuthZ platform infrastructure.

Your Qualifications

As a successful candidate you will bring 4+ years of experience in a similar position to the table with a proven record in building scalable and resilient distributed systems using modern cloud technologies.

  • Practical knowledge of Golang
  • Experience with container orchestration and automation in cloud architectures (Kubernetes, Helm, Terraform)
  • Experience with modern observability principles, stacks and tools like Prometheus / Thanos, Alert manager, Grafana
  • Experience in cloud environments such as Azure, GCP, AWS or equivalent
  • Fluent in English, German or French would be an advantage
Bonus skills and qualifications
  • Knowledge of SCIM
  • Hands‑on experience building REST APIs
  • Experience with modern authentication mechanisms and protocols (OAuth2, OIDC)
  • Hands‑on experience with authorization models such as RBAC, ABAC and especially ReBAC

About Open Systems

Open Systems is a leading provider of native Managed SASE solutions, converging network and security functions on a cloud‑native platform. Founded in 1990, the Swiss cybersecurity company, headquartered in Zurich, supports businesses and organizations in more than 180 countries with a holistic, customer‑centric service model that guarantees 24x7 expert support. The combination of an innovative platform, integrated solutions, and excellent service ensures secure, reliable, and worry‑free network operations – even within the complex IT infrastructures of global manufacturing companies and NGOs.

This solution delivers reliable connectivity across cloud, on‑premises, and hybrid environments, while offering an exceptional user experience through an intuitive customer portal. Powered by a centralized data platform and 24×7 managed services, Open Systems not only enhances security but also boosts operational efficiency and accelerates innovation – enabling secure networks that grow with your business.
